Philip Pullman, however, *totally* entranced me as an adult-- so it was with much interest that I read Pullman's views of Lewis and his books, reframed in an article in the _Atlantic_ a couple of years ago. The article, by Gregg Easterbrook, is actually a defense of Lewis: a rebuttal of Pullman's and other's views that the _Chronicles_of_Narnia_ were racist and misogynist, both.
That said, Easterbrook does allow, in fact, that there were "passages that made me wince", and turns his eye toward issues of intellectual freedom.
